Liam Burt's career has also included time at Shamrock Rovers, Shelbourne, Bohemian FC, Alloa Athletic, Rangers B, Dumbarton, and Rangers.
On the international stage, Liam Burt has represented Scotland U21, Scotland U19, and Scotland U17.

Throughout their career, Liam Burt has won 4 titles: Premier Division (2023) with Shamrock Rovers, Premier Division (2024) with Shelbourne, and Challenge Cup (2015/2016) and Championship (2015/2016) with Rangers.
